Hotels with EV charging and verified sustainability credentials in New York City

Every hotel on this list operates in New York City, offers EV charging access, and holds a verified sustainability credential backed by third-party certification or published measurable metrics. Selection required documented evidence — corporate mission statements and unverified brand pledges did not qualify. EV charging is either on the hotel property or at a confirmed third-party garage within walking distance.

How we selected these hotels

Each hotel on this page passed a two-stage check. First, we confirmed the property holds either a named third-party certification (LEED, Green Key, EarthCheck, Green Globe, GSTC, or Energy Star) or a published sustainability report with specific numeric results. Second, we confirmed EV charging availability, either directly on the hotel property or at a named third-party garage within walking distance.

Tier 1 properties came first in the ranking. Within Tier 1, LEED Platinum outranks LEED Gold, which outranks LEED Silver, and so on down through Green Key and Energy Star. Where two hotels share the same certification level, the higher star rating wins. Alphabetical order breaks any remaining ties.

Tier 2 properties appear only after all qualifying Tier 1 hotels. Within Tier 2, properties with published numeric reduction targets rank above those with only qualitative reporting.

Tips for EV drivers booking in NYC

  • Call the hotel directly before arrival to confirm charger availability and connector type — Level 2 (J1772) and DC fast chargers are not interchangeable for all vehicles.
  • If charging is at a third-party garage, ask the hotel concierge to reserve a charging bay in advance, especially during peak seasons.
  • Manhattan parking garages charge separately for EV charging time on top of standard parking rates — budget for both.
  • PlugShare and ChargePoint apps show real-time charger availability at garages near your hotel if the hotel's own chargers are occupied.

EV charging in NYC hotels: what to expect

New York City hotels face real constraints on on-property EV charging. Most Midtown Manhattan properties have no dedicated parking structure, so EV charging typically means a partnership with a nearby garage. That arrangement is common and workable, but it does require a short walk and a separate payment.

Properties in neighborhoods with more physical space, such as the Upper West Side near Central Park, are more likely to have on-property charging bays. When a hotel lists EV charging as an amenity without specifying the location, it is worth asking whether the charger is in the hotel's own garage or at a partner facility two blocks away. Both options appear on this page, and the evChargingLocation field for each hotel makes the distinction clear.

Two of the five hotels, [1 Hotel Central Park](/hotels/1-hotel-central-park) and [Kimpton Hotel Eventi](/hotels/kimpton-hotel-eventi), have on-property EV chargers. The other three direct guests to confirmed third-party garages within a 2 to 3-minute walk. Each hotel entry on this page specifies the exact location and garage name in the EV charging details.

The on-property chargers at [1 Hotel Central Park](/hotels/1-hotel-central-park) include both Tesla destination chargers and Level 2 J1772 connectors. [Kimpton Hotel Eventi](/hotels/kimpton-hotel-eventi) operates Level 2 J1772 chargers. The third-party garages serving the Westin, Marriott Marquis, and Hilton Midtown all operate Level 2 J1772 chargers. Call ahead to confirm connector availability before arrival, as garage inventory changes.

Tier 1 hotels hold a named third-party certification, such as LEED, Green Key, or Energy Star, that requires audited and verifiable performance data. Tier 2 hotels have published sustainability reports with specific measurable results, such as a documented percentage reduction in energy or water use, but do not currently hold a named third-party certification. Four of the five hotels on this page are Tier 1.

Certification status was verified against the USGBC project database and the EPA's Energy Star certified buildings database as of early 2026. Certifications can lapse or be upgraded, so checking the relevant database directly before booking is a good idea if the credential is a deciding factor for you.

On-property charging fees vary by hotel. [1 Hotel Central Park](/hotels/1-hotel-central-park) and [Kimpton Hotel Eventi](/hotels/kimpton-hotel-eventi) both include EV charging as a guest amenity, though fees can apply depending on your rate. At the third-party garages serving the Westin, Marriott Marquis, and Hilton Midtown, guests pay the garage's standard EV charging rate on top of any parking fee. Rates at Manhattan garages typically run between $0.30 and $0.50 per kWh for Level 2 charging.
